WebA calcium blood test measures the level of calcium in your blood. There are two types of calcium blood tests: Total calcium: This test measures the calcium attached to certain proteins in your blood and “free” or unattached calcium. Total calcium is often included in a routine blood screening test called a basic metabolic panel (BMP). WebNational Center for Biotechnology Information

WebSep 6, 2024 · Increasing time between meals made male mice healthier overall and live longer compared to mice who ate more frequently, according to a new study published in the Sept. 6, 2024 issue of Cell Metabolism.Scientists from the National Institute on Aging (NIA) at the National Institutes of Health, the University of Wisconsin-Madison, and the … WebFasting means that you abstain from all food and fluids other than water for a period of 8-14 hours prior to your test. Continue to take any medication unless advised otherwise by your doctor. Alcohol should not be consumed for 72 hours (3 days) prior to the test. You should avoid smoking during the fasting period.

In fact, many people are a combination of several metabolic body … file manager scrolling lagWebOct 8, 2024 · Answer From Francisco Lopez-Jimenez, M.D. Maybe. Fasting means not eating or drinking for a certain period of time. Some types of fasting may improve some risk factors related to heart health. But researchers aren't exactly sure why.
